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Tuesday began his 25th year as the head of a government, and what is being claimed as India’s “biggest” AI film challenge has been launched to mark this special occasion.

The Bluekraft Digital Foundation, a non-profit organisation, has launched ‘Vision Bharat AI Film Challenge’ as Modi completes 24 years in governance.

Recommended Stories

“As Prime Minister Narendra Modi completes 24 continuous as head of an elected government, ‘Vision Bharat AI Film Challenge’ invites creators to participate in India’s biggest AI Film Challenge,” said Akhilesh Mishra, CEO, Bluekraft Digital Foundation, in a post on X.

Mishra invited “rigorous, well-researched, and creative” 60-second AI-powered films as entries to the competition, which he said has been designed “to help visualise the Prime Minister’s vision”.

“Entries may focus on his life and leadership, decisive actions, guiding philosophy for a Viksit Bharat, or the impact of key policies,” Mishra wrote on X. “Selected works will gain national recognition, prizes, and opportunities for further development, with showcase potential at a dedicated AI Film Festival.”

He said the entries will be evaluated by a jury of filmmakers, artists, digital creators, and technology leaders on creativity, cultural authenticity, and technical execution.

The entries can be submitted through: https://bluekraft.in and https://aifilmchallenge.in, and the deadline for this is October 26.

Modi, who completed 24 years in governance, said improving the lives of people and contributing to the progress of this great nation have been his constant endeavour.

In a series of posts on X, he noted that he had taken oath on this day in 2001 as Gujarat’s chief minister for the first time.

“Thanks to the continuous blessings of my fellow Indians, I am entering my 25th year of serving as the head of a Government. My gratitude to the people of India,” Modi said on social media. “Through all these years, it has been my constant endeavour to improve the lives of our people and contribute to the progress of this great nation that has nurtured us all.”

After spearheading the BJP to victory in three consecutive assembly elections in Gujarat, Modi has led the BJP-led National Democratic Alliance to win in three successive national elections.

As an incumbent, he has never faced an electoral defeat and holds the record as the longest head of a government, including as CM for more than 12-and-a-half years, among all PMs.
